First off, let's talk a bit about what Matrine Liquid 10% is. Matrine is a natural botanical pesticide extracted from the roots of Sophora flavescens, a traditional Chinese medicinal plant. It's been around for ages and has a long - standing history of use in pest control. The 10% liquid formulation is a convenient and effective way to use this natural pesticide.
When it comes to tobacco plants, they're prone to a variety of pests. Aphids, for example, can be a real headache. These small insects suck the sap out of the tobacco leaves, causing stunted growth and reduced yields. Other common pests include tobacco hornworms, which can munch through large swaths of leaves in no time.
So, can Matrine Liquid 10% help with these problems? The answer is a big yes! Matrine works in multiple ways to combat pests on tobacco plants. For one, it has contact toxicity. When sprayed on the plants, it can directly kill pests upon contact. It also has stomach toxicity. Once the pests ingest the treated leaves, the matrine can disrupt their digestive systems and ultimately lead to their demise.
Moreover, Matrine Liquid 10% is relatively safe for the environment compared to many synthetic pesticides. It's biodegradable, which means it won't stick around in the soil or water for a long time. This is a huge plus for tobacco growers who are concerned about sustainable farming practices. And it's also less harmful to beneficial insects like bees and ladybugs, which play a crucial role in pollination and natural pest control.


Let's talk about how to use Matrine Liquid 10% on tobacco plants. It's important to follow the proper dilution instructions. Generally, you'll want to mix the liquid with water at the recommended ratio. This ensures that you're applying the right amount of the active ingredient to effectively control pests without harming the plants. You can use a simple handheld sprayer or a larger agricultural sprayer, depending on the size of your tobacco fields. Make sure to cover the leaves thoroughly, including the undersides where pests often hide.
